6 7 REMEHA FUSION OVERVIEW SIGNIFICANT ENERGY SAVINGS FOR YOUR BUILDING The main features of a heat pump Remeha Fusion performance Return temperature = 35ºC/ T=10–15ºC _________ Return temperature = 40ºC/ T=10–15ºC _________ 42 152% 36 144% A heat pump is a device that pumps heat from A to B. One application of this technology is, for example, a refrigerator. Heat is pumped from the refrigerator to the surrounding area, which reduces the temperature in the refrigerator.
